X-Git-Url: https://juplo.de/gitweb/?a=blobdiff_plain;f=src%2Fmain%2Fjava%2Fde%2Fjuplo%2Fdemo%2FDemoApplication.java;h=2917409fad4c38f16e59800fc1e9bb440a16ea5e;hb=9639c89ecb4d10ffd9cfd6f4889247ae1881fc3a;hp=76f6fe4df15157ffa8fd0db3a26ab23a046edd8a;hpb=457b4d27ce2f689218fdebe45761487ddacf2a73;p=demos%2Fspring-boot diff --git a/src/main/java/de/juplo/demo/DemoApplication.java b/src/main/java/de/juplo/demo/DemoApplication.java index 76f6fe4..2917409 100644 --- a/src/main/java/de/juplo/demo/DemoApplication.java +++ b/src/main/java/de/juplo/demo/DemoApplication.java @@ -1,12 +1,27 @@ package de.juplo.demo; +import org.springframework.beans.factory.annotation.Value; import org.springframework.boot.SpringApplication; import org.springframework.boot.autoconfigure.SpringBootApplication; +import org.springframework.context.annotation.Bean; + @SpringBootApplication -public class DemoApplication { +public class DemoApplication +{ + @Value("${build.version}") + String projectVersion; + + + @Bean + public BackendVersionInterceptor backendVersionInterceptor() + { + return new BackendVersionInterceptor(projectVersion); + } + - public static void main(String[] args) { + public static void main(String[] args) + { SpringApplication.run(DemoApplication.class, args); }